Analysis
The most recent figure for school age population, primary education, female in Ireland is 274,561, measured in 2024.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 1.1% on the previous year and up 6.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, school age population, primary education, female in Ireland peaked at 278,578 in 2020 and was at its lowest, 211,037, in 2002.
Ireland ranks 108th of 222 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 24 years of available data.
School age population, primary education, female in Ireland,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2001 | 211,831 | — |
| 2002 | 211,037 | -0.4% |
| 2003 | 212,125 | +0.5% |
| 2004 | 212,963 | +0.4% |
| 2005 | 214,058 | +0.5% |
| 2006 | 217,870 | +1.8% |
| 2007 | 224,687 | +3.1% |
| 2008 | 232,186 | +3.3% |
| 2009 | 237,212 | +2.2% |
| 2010 | 239,330 | +0.9% |
| 2011 | 241,179 | +0.8% |
| 2012 | 247,766 | +2.7% |
| 2013 | 252,801 | +2.0% |
| 2014 | 258,223 | +2.1% |
| 2015 | 263,056 | +1.9% |
| 2016 | 266,932 | +1.5% |
| 2017 | 271,705 | +1.8% |
| 2018 | 274,790 | +1.1% |
| 2019 | 277,237 | +0.9% |
| 2020 | 278,578 | +0.5% |
| 2021 | 276,800 | -0.6% |
| 2022 | 277,186 | +0.1% |
| 2023 | 277,647 | +0.2% |
| 2024 | 274,561 | -1.1% |
